QZ Series 

FlexiShield Quartz (QZ) – Spectrally-Selective Window Film

FlexiShield Quartz is a high-clarity, spectrally-selective film designed to reduce heat while keeping interiors bright and natural. It blocks a significant amount of infrared radiation while maintaining high visible light transmission. Quartz delivers strong cooling performance without altering the look of the glass, making it ideal for residential and architectural settings that require minimal tint and maximum comfort.

  • Available VLT Models:

    • QZ 70 AGS (70 VLT)

    • QZ 60 AGS (60 VLT)

    • QZ 70 HCB (70 VLT)

    • QZ 70 HCG (70 VLT)

    • QZ 65 MPM (65 VLT)

    Key Specs:

    • Infrared Rejection: up to 84 %

    • Total Solar Energy Rejection: 41 to 56 %

    • UV Rejection: 99 %

    • Glare Reduction: 11 to 52 %

    • Shading Coefficient: 0.53 to 0.75

ES/EB

FlexiShield Élan (ES / EB) – Metallized Silver & Bronze Window Film

FlexiShield Élan delivers metallized solar-control performance in two architectural styles: Silver for a clean, modern reflective look, and Bronze for a richer, warmer aesthetic. These films provide strong heat rejection, balanced glare control, and improved interior comfort while maintaining long-term durability and visual stability.

  • Available VLT Models:
    Élan Silver (ES):

    • 50 VLT

    • 30 VLT

    • 15 VLT

     

    Élan Bronze (EB):

    • 50 VLT

    • 30 VLT

    • 15 VLT

     

    Key Specs:

    • Infrared Rejection: 63 to 82%

    • Total Solar Energy Rejection: 60 to 72%

    • UV Rejection: 99%

    • Glare Reduction: 69 to 88%

    • Shading Coefficient: 0.28 to 0.46

TR Series

FlexiShield Terra (TR) – Titanium Nitride Hybrid Window Film

FlexiShield Terra uses titanium nitride hybrid construction to provide a neutral, natural appearance with strong solar-performance characteristics. Terra improves indoor comfort, reduces glare, protects furnishings from UV exposure, and maintains long-term clarity without fading or discoloration.

  • Available VLT Models:

    • TR 50 (50 VLT)

    • TR 40 (40 VLT)

    • TR 30 (30 VLT)

    • TR 20 (20 VLT)

    • TR 10 (10 VLT)

     

    Key Specs:

    • Infrared Rejection: 78 to 85%

    • Total Solar Energy Rejection: 46 to 58%

    • UV Rejection: 99%

    • Glare Reduction: 30 to 57%

    • Shading Coefficient: 0.50 to 0.67

FT Series

FlexiShield Forte (FT) – Stainless Steel Architectural Window Film

FlexiShield Forte is a stainless-steel metallized window film engineered for strong heat rejection, glare reduction, and enhanced durability. Its metallic finish supports modern architectural design while providing long-lasting UV protection and improved interior comfort.

  • Available VLT Models:

    • FT 50 (50 VLT)

    • FT 35 (35 VLT)

    • FT 20 (20 VLT)

     

    Key Specs:

    • Infrared Rejection: 65 to 80%

    • Total Solar Energy Rejection: 51 to 63%

    • UV Rejection: 99%

    • Glare Reduction: 52 to 82%

    • Shading Coefficient: 0.38 to 0.63

NV Series (Safety Film)

FlexiShield Novara (NV) – Architectural Safety Window Film

FlexiShield Novara is a multi-thickness safety and security film designed to strengthen glass and improve protection in high-traffic or high-risk environments. It helps retain glass in break events, resists forced entry, and supports safety compliance while maintaining clear optics.

  • Available Thickness Models (Named by Thickness, Not VLT):

    • NV 4 mil

    • NV 7 mil

    • NV 8 mil

    • NV 12 mil

    • NV 15 mil


    Key Specs:

    • Visible Light Transmission: 87 to 89%

    • UV Rejection: 99%

    • Shading Coefficient: 0.89 to 0.91

    • Solar Energy Rejection: 13 to 18%

    • Glare Reduction: 2 to 4%

    • Impact Resistance: increases proportionally with film thickness
